+use crate::std::fmt;
+
+/// A general error that can occur when working with UUIDs.
+#[derive(Clone, Debug, Eq, Hash, PartialEq)]
+pub struct Error(pub(crate) ErrorKind);
+
+#[derive(Clone, Debug, Eq, Hash, PartialEq)]
+pub(crate) enum ErrorKind {
+ /// Invalid character in the [`Uuid`] string.
+ ///
+ /// [`Uuid`]: ../struct.Uuid.html
+ Char { character: char, index: usize },
+ /// A simple [`Uuid`] didn't contain 32 characters.
+ ///
+ /// [`Uuid`]: ../struct.Uuid.html
+ SimpleLength { len: usize },
+ /// A byte array didn't contain 16 bytes
+ ByteLength { len: usize },
+ /// A hyphenated [`Uuid`] didn't contain 5 groups
+ ///
+ /// [`Uuid`]: ../struct.Uuid.html
+ GroupCount { count: usize },
+ /// A hyphenated [`Uuid`] had a group that wasn't the right length
+ ///
+ /// [`Uuid`]: ../struct.Uuid.html
+ GroupLength {
+ group: usize,
+ len: usize,
+ index: usize,
+ },
+ /// The input was not a valid UTF8 string
+ InvalidUTF8,
+ /// Some other error occurred.
+ Other,
+}
+
+/// A string that is guaranteed to fail to parse to a [`Uuid`].
+///
+/// This type acts as a lightweight error indicator, suggesting
+/// that the string cannot be parsed but offering no error
+/// details. To get details, use `InvalidUuid::into_err`.
+///
+/// [`Uuid`]: ../struct.Uuid.html
+#[derive(Clone, Debug, Eq, Hash, PartialEq)]
+pub struct InvalidUuid<'a>(pub(crate) &'a [u8]);
+
+impl<'a> InvalidUuid<'a> {
+ /// Converts the lightweight error type into detailed diagnostics.
+ pub fn into_err(self) -> Error {
+ // Check whether or not the input was ever actually a valid UTF8 string
+ let input_str = match std::str::from_utf8(self.0) {
+ Ok(s) => s,
+ Err(_) => return Error(ErrorKind::InvalidUTF8),
+ };
+
+ let (uuid_str, offset, simple) = match input_str.as_bytes() {
+ [b'{', s @ .., b'}'] => (s, 1, false),
+ [b'u', b'r', b'n', b':', b'u', b'u', b'i', b'd', b':', s @ ..] => {
+ (s, "urn:uuid:".len(), false)
+ }
+ s => (s, 0, true),
+ };
+
+ let mut hyphen_count = 0;
+ let mut group_bounds = [0; 4];
+
+ // SAFETY: the byte array came from a valid utf8 string,
+ // and is aligned along char boundaries.
+ let uuid_str = unsafe { std::str::from_utf8_unchecked(uuid_str) };
+
+ for (index, character) in uuid_str.char_indices() {
+ let byte = character as u8;
+ if character as u32 - byte as u32 > 0 {
+ // Multibyte char
+ return Error(ErrorKind::Char {
+ character,
+ index: index + offset + 1,
+ });
+ } else if byte == b'-' {
+ // While we search, also count group breaks
+ if hyphen_count < 4 {
+ group_bounds[hyphen_count] = index;
+ }
+ hyphen_count += 1;
+ } else if !matches!(byte, b'0'..=b'9' | b'a'..=b'f' | b'A'..=b'F') {
+ // Non-hex char
+ return Error(ErrorKind::Char {
+ character: byte as char,
+ index: index + offset + 1,
+ });
+ }
+ }
+
+ if hyphen_count == 0 && simple {
+ // This means that we tried and failed to parse a simple uuid.
+ // Since we verified that all the characters are valid, this means
+ // that it MUST have an invalid length.
+ Error(ErrorKind::SimpleLength {
+ len: input_str.len(),
+ })
+ } else if hyphen_count != 4 {
+ // We tried to parse a hyphenated variant, but there weren't
+ // 5 groups (4 hyphen splits).
+ Error(ErrorKind::GroupCount {
+ count: hyphen_count + 1,
+ })
+ } else {
+ // There are 5 groups, one of them has an incorrect length
+ const BLOCK_STARTS: [usize; 5] = [0, 9, 14, 19, 24];
+ for i in 0..4 {
+ if group_bounds[i] != BLOCK_STARTS[i + 1] - 1 {
+ return Error(ErrorKind::GroupLength {
+ group: i,
+ len: group_bounds[i] - BLOCK_STARTS[i],
+ index: offset + BLOCK_STARTS[i] + 1,
+ });
+ }
+ }
+
+ // The last group must be too long
+ Error(ErrorKind::GroupLength {
+ group: 4,
+ len: input_str.len() - BLOCK_STARTS[4],
+ index: offset + BLOCK_STARTS[4] + 1,
+ })
+ }
+ }
+}
+
+// NOTE: This impl is part of the public API. Breaking changes to it should be carefully considered
+impl fmt::Display for Error {
+ fn fmt(&self, f: &mut fmt::Formatter) -> fmt::Result {
+ match self.0 {
+ ErrorKind::Char {
+ character, index, ..
+ } => {
+ write!(f, "invalid character: expected an optional prefix of `urn:uuid:` followed by [0-9a-fA-F-], found `{}` at {}", character, index)
+ }
+ ErrorKind::SimpleLength { len } => {
+ write!(
+ f,
+ "invalid length: expected length 32 for simple format, found {}",
+ len
+ )
+ }
+ ErrorKind::ByteLength { len } => {
+ write!(f, "invalid length: expected 16 bytes, found {}", len)
+ }
+ ErrorKind::GroupCount { count } => {
+ write!(f, "invalid group count: expected 5, found {}", count)
+ }
+ ErrorKind::GroupLength { group, len, .. } => {
+ let expected = [8, 4, 4, 4, 12][group];
+ write!(
+ f,
+ "invalid group length in group {}: expected {}, found {}",
+ group, expected, len
+ )
+ }
+ ErrorKind::InvalidUTF8 => write!(f, "non-UTF8 input"),
+ ErrorKind::Other => write!(f, "failed to parse a UUID"),
+ }
+ }
+}
+
+#[cfg(feature = "std")]
+mod std_support {
+ use super::*;
+ use crate::std::error;
+
+ impl error::Error for Error {}
+}
